Released April 9th, 2019, 'Aux' stars John Rhys-Davies, Tanya Franks, Rosie Fellner, Theo Devaney The movie has a runtime of about 1 hr 23 min, and received a user score of 63 (out of 100) on TMDb, which put together reviews from 6 well-known users.
What, so now you want to know what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"When two young boys playing in the woods discover a military bunker they unintentionally release the ghost of a World War II auxiliary soldier who mistakenly believes the Nazis have landed"
